A property management company in Indianapolis had a client that purchased a warehouse in South Bend, IN, and requested a full inspection and roof condition report from our service department.
Our team evaluated each individual roof section and clearly marked two sections that needed replacement due to age and system failure risk. Everything was documented, photographed, and delivered with recommendations.
Sure enough—after the very first snow of the season, we received a call from the property management team.The areas we had flagged were failing exactly the way our report had predicted.
Because they trusted our documentation and expertise, they moved forward quickly with replacement. Their decisiveness prevented further interior damage, operational disruption, and costly emergency repairs.
